Letter 2 [addressed to Samuel Timmins, Director of the Birmingham Central Library; 03.05.1878]

Transcription

Tomorrow the parcel containing the album leaves Berlin and will be in London Monday the 6th. There it is addressed to Mr. Truebners booksellers 57/59 Ludgate Hill, who is requested by me to send the parcel over to You. If you dont get it in right time please write two words to Mr. T and ask him.

As soon at the album is in your hands, I hope you will be kind enough to send me a telegram. – There are still some photos wanting, which I shall send later. My best compliments to the Members of the board of the free libraries and my love to Mr. Timmins and to You

Yours ever - Leo
